¿Cuál es el orden para que los niños pequeños aprendan programación?
1. Programación de bloques
La "Programación de bloques" es una técnica básica que le permite crear código arrastrando bloques u otras señales visuales, en lugar de escribir código basado en texto manualmente. . Existen muchos programas que pueden ayudarlo a comenzar con la codificación de arrastrar y soltar, incluidos MIT Scratch, Code Studio de Code.org y Google Blocky.
2. Python como lenguaje de programación inicial
Python es un lenguaje sencillo para principiantes. Debido a que se pone poco énfasis en la sintaxis, Python es un lenguaje que representa la simplicidad. Leer un buen programa Python es como leer en inglés. Le permite concentrarse en resolver problemas en lugar de descubrir el idioma en sí.
3. JavaScript es uno de los lenguajes de programación más útiles
JavaScript no es tan simple como Python, pero puede ejecutarse en todas las plataformas: Mac, Windows, iOS y Android, etc. . esperar. Todos los navegadores web modernos e incluso los dispositivos más nuevos, como los relojes inteligentes, utilizan JavaScript para algunas funciones.
4. Después de JavaScript, pruebe Ruby y Ruby on Rails
Ruby on Rails es un marco que facilita el desarrollo, la implementación y el mantenimiento de aplicaciones web. Aunque Ruby y Ruby on Rails tienen nombres similares, en realidad son muy diferentes. Ruby es un lenguaje de secuencias de comandos, al igual que Python, pero Ruby on Rails es un marco de aplicaciones web. En otras palabras, Ruby es el lenguaje y Ruby on Rails es una herramienta que facilita la creación de sitios web utilizando el lenguaje Ruby.